-
Главная страница - netsaita.ru/delta/index.html фон остается при любом разрешении экрана правильный.
Внутренняя страница - netsaita.ru/delta/agency.html
Как сделать фон фиксированный, не прокручиваемый, если фон состоит из двух div'ных слоев:
Код:
#nebo {height: 60%}
#footer {top: 60%; height: 40%; background-image : url('images/sea.jpg'); background-color:#1E456C; background-repeat:repeat-x; background-position-y:top}
Фон неба прописан в body
Код:
body {height: 100%; margin : 0; padding : 0; font-family : Tahoma, Arial, Verdana, Helvetica, sans-serif; font-size : 12px; color:#FFFFFF; background-image : url('images/nebo.jpg'); background-color:#366EBA; background-repeat:repeat-x; background-position-y:top}
Буду благодарна за любой совет.
-
Цитата:
Originally posted by netsaita@Jun 14 2007, 13:57
Как сделать фон фиксированный, не прокручиваемый
<div align='right'>[Only registered and activated users can see links. Click Here To Register...]
[/quote]
background-attachment: fixed;
-
background-attachment: fixed; - не работает, ведь фоном являются 2 картинки.
1 картинка занимает 60% экрана, вторая - 40%.
Если появляется вертикальная полоса прокрутки, то фон так и заполняет всего 60% и 40%.
А после прокрутки пусто. Нужно эти две картинки зафиксировать, чтобы при прокрутке вниз фон из двух картинок остался на месте.
Посмотрите, пожалуйста, на страницу netsaita.ru/delta/agency.html при разрешении 800х600...
-
Цитата:
Originally posted by netsaita@Jun 14 2007, 14:39
Посмотрите, пожалуйста, на страницу netsaita.ru/delta/agency.html при разрешении 800х600...
<div align='right'>[Only registered and activated users can see links. Click Here To Register...]
[/quote]
Да это-то понятно... смотрел... Пустите тогда все одной картинкой... и зафиксируйте ее... Или попробуйте привязать один фон к элементу html, а второй фон – к body...
-
#footer {
z-index:1;
position:fixed; bottom: 0px;
height: 40%; width:100%;
...
}
* {
z-index: 2;
}
+ добавляем к этому какой-нибудь хак фиксящий fixed для старых ие